Scrolling iframes html5 download

In the space that you have cut out of the page, you can then feed in an external webpage. The tag creates an inline frame for embedding thirdparty content media, applets, etc. Example an iframe has the dimensions 500px by 500px then make the content to display in the iframe 499px by 499 px. These frames are essentially a section of your page that you cut out. Whether you should use css instead is a matter of opinion. If you use the frameborder0 and scrollingno attributes the validation service on varnings are. That is the only way to get the app to be encapsulated as a chrome app, and also work well in all browsers and platforms. Html5 no longer allows the scrolling attribute on an iframe element. In this tutorial, you will see the use of tag in html5. The scrolling works with html5 and responsive templates and in all newer css3 compliant web browsers as well as on ipad and iphone. Its downloaded probably because there is not adobe reader plugin installed. Inline frame allows you to open new document inside the main browsers window.

Set iframe height to fit its content jquery frameloader. Scroll iframes on iphone and ipad david walsh blog. When it comes to html5, scrolling attribute is no longer supported but i still need to remove the scroll bars how to do that. To turn off scrolling in html5 you are supposed to use the. The css on an embedded form is set to not show scrollbars. Also note that programatically removing an s src attribute e. The use of overflow is not reliable to stop scrolling. Why were frames deprecated in html5, but not iframes. A document can be embedded into the current document using an inline frame. While the iframe will render the content, depending upon the width of the origin page, the content may render in a way that requires vertical scrolling, horizontal scrolling, or both. Adam is a technical writer who specializes in developer documentation and tutorials. How and when to use iframes inline frames lifewire. Html5 no longer allows the scrolling attribute on an element. Alternative to iframe in html5 are embed and object embed.

The scrolling window, show in the sidebar on this page, uses an html iframe page embedded into your webpage with a javascript to create the scrolling feature. Also note that programatically removing an iframe s src attribute e. Jan 22, 2020 inline frames, usually just called iframes, are the only type of frame allowed in html5. Was used to set the alignment of an inline frame relative to surrounding elements. Simple responsive scrolling text using css3 and html code. An inline frame renders using tag a document can be embedded into the current document using an inline frame usage of iframe iframe html is an inline frame. The frameset and frame tags are not supported in html5. Download scripts click below to download as shown in the sidebar examples the embedded news window or scrolling news addons with all files and examples. Infinite scroll image gallery with mobile support html5. I want to use only html5 specs, is it possible to solve using only html5. The frameborder, marginwidth, longdesc, scrolling, marginheight attributes deprecated in html5.

Wildoo, you can hide scrollbars, if you make the content to dispaly in the iframe the same dimensions. Jul 02, 2014 the solution suggested here has been applied to a site that needs to generate reports and contain them in an iframe. Indicates when the browser should provide a scrollbar for the frame. Without this the page will scroll when you scroll the iframe area. So if you want to remove or change the scroll bars, you should use the. The image gallery preloads three images and keeps them showing as the visitor scrolls down the page. You should use css instead to achieve the same effect. Jun 20, 2017 while the iframe will render the content, depending upon the width of the origin page, the content may render in a way that requires vertical scrolling, horizontal scrolling, or both.

Using iframe html and css code to embed applications and webages into another. Responsive iframes plugin for jquery free jquery plugins. Iframes do not make a website a framed site and do not affect seo. This example contains a horizontal slider on the second page. Keep same and cross domain iframes sized to their content with support for windowcontent resizing, in page links, nesting and multiple iframes.

Most of the attributes of the tag, including name, class, frameborder, id, longdesc, marginheight, marginwidth, name, scrolling, style, and title behave exactly like the corresponding attributes for the tag note. In noncompliant browsers the scroller will appear the same but will not animate. In this tutorial, you will see the use and implementation of iframe tag. An iframe is html code that you can use to embed one html page, pdf page, another website, or other web safe file into a another webpage inside a window. In html5, these two attributes are considered obsolete. Why dont we want scrolling the iframe doesnt work like the old frameset and adjust to the height of the visiting browser.

Some of the attributes that are valid in html4 are not valid in html5, for example, frameborder and scrolling. How to write frameborder and scrolling for iframe in. Nov 29, 20 i want to use only html5 specs, is it possible to solve using only html5. Download the package and customize according to your needs. In this case ie it doesnt matter which version doesnt know. It is recommended that authors use a combination of css to style the as needed and the new html5 seamless attribute. Inline frames, usually just called iframes, are the only type of frame allowed in html5.

Its has been deprecated from new html5 specifications, but still supported on browsers. While all browsers support iframe, there is limited support for some html5 features, and none of the browsers support srcdoc, sandbox, and seamless attributes. Preserving aspect ratio for iframes jquery keepratio. The html inline frame element iframe represents a nested.

Scrolling sticky menu with bootstrap single page website template with a fixed menu and full width page sections that adjust to the height of the browser. It is a good practice to always include a title attribute for the. How to style iframes with css understanding how iframes work in website design. If scroll bars are not needed on the iframes, scrolling attribute can continue. Unfortunately, drop down menu will not overlap iframe. The iframe element is not valid in strict xhtml or strict html4, but will validate with a transitional xhtml or html4 doctype declaration.

Look at the iframe example below, showing its usage together with src property. Then the ui process has to be fixed to make uiscrollviews for scrollable frames. For those that are not aware of the seamless attribute, here is some quick info. See the included help page for setup instructions and options. Above figure is output of iframe tag in the above example four different windows have been added in a single window in which first window is a web page, second is the pdf link, third is a pdf document and forth is a. Download script click below to download the scrolling images addon as shown in the sidebar example. Is there a way to fix it i want to download additional content when user. In noncompliant browsers the scroller will appear the same. This is used by screen readers to read out what the content of the iframe is. It detects touch devices and mobile users can load images pressing a button when they reach the bottom of the page. Responsive for desktop, tablet, smartphones and other mobile devices. The tag specifies an inline frame an inline frame is used to embed another document within the current html document.

Edit the overflow in the css code to visible or scroll or hidden or auto. An iframe comes in handy when a developer needs to display a webpage in another webpage. A basic iframes tutorial covering the target and scrolling attributes. Auto resize iframe to fit parent jquery responsive. I just found you website and downloaded the free version for noncommercial sites. Documents containing iframes will validate with an html5 doctype. Somehow i manage to scroll the div, but it does not look pleasant. The css owerflow and border style is currently not supported in iframes in ie8. This allows for some measure of security for the parent document and visitors to the parent document when embedding untrusted content. Modern browsers implement iframe so that the scroll bars are present, if needed for accessing all of the content, but not otherwise.

Chances are, you are using the frameborder andor scrolling attributes. You have to manually set the height of an iframe height100% has no effect. The iframe in html5 also takes on additional features in that it can be sandboxed, allowing the parent document to decide what gets executed within it. Although the content of the frame and the web page are independent, they can interact through javascript.

They are declared as obsolete, but according to html5 cr, browsers are expected to keep supporting to them. The css owerlow style is currently not supported in iframes in ie9. Was used to toggle the display of a border around an iframe. The iframe tag specifies an inline frame an inline frame is used to embed another document within the current html document. The download priority of the resource in the s src attribute.

Most of the attributes of the tag, including name, class, frameborder, id, longdesc, marginheight, marginwidth, name, scrolling, style, and title behave exactly like the corresponding attributes for the tag. It embeds one page into another look at the iframe example below, showing its usage together with src property. Embedding an uploaded html page in an iframe canvas lms. An inline frame is used to embed another document within the current html document. If you want to change one of the elements scrollbar state, use the overflow style property, or if you want to change the scrollbar state of the entire page internet explorer, use the scroll attribute. Html5 iframe scrollbar and frameborder html5 iframe scrollbar and frameborder. Iframe with scrolling in the above code snippet we are having the scroll bar function in the iframe, if we want to scroll the iframe we need to add the scrolling as yes and if we need to have no scroll function we need to add the scrollling as no. In fact, html5 describes the attribute scrolling yes as mapping to the css setting overflow. The solution suggested here has been applied to a site that needs to generate reports and contain them in an iframe. Html5 templates the image gallery preloads three images and keeps them showing as the visitor scrolls down the page. Obsolete frameborder and scrolling attributes for iframe if you have a web page that contains a frameborder setting within an iframe element, e. Using this element, can add external application or interactive content like plugin etc tag w3docs.